About the Department

This position offers a flexible weekday schedule, typically between 7:00 AM and 5:00 PM, with occasional evenings and weekends required for trainings or special events.

Under the direction of the S.T.A.R.S. Coordinator and in collaboration with Site Supervisors, the Senior Program Aide supports the daily operations of the City of Yucaipa’s S.T.A.R.S. Expanded Learning Program. This position plays a critical role in maintaining program consistency, ensuring adequate staffing across sites, organizing program materials, and providing clerical support. The Senior Program Aide also serves as a key point of contact for families, school personnel, and City staff, offering exceptional customer service and promoting a safe, inclusive, and enriching environment for all program participants.

This position offers a flexible weekday schedule, typically between 7:00 AM and 5:00 PM, with occasional evenings and weekends required for trainings or special events. 

Employees in this position average 23 hours per week during the academic year, with a maximum of 950 hours.

Position Duties

The typical duties of this position include:
  • Monitoring and recording staff attendance across multiple elementary and middle school sites;
  • Coordinating daily staffing schedules;
  • Creating a welcoming and professional presence across sites while supporting staff and program consistency;
  • Offering excellent customer service to families, school personnel, and the program team;
  • Organizing and preparing lesson materials, activity supplies, and event resources;
  • Maintaining and restocking inventory across sites; reporting low supplies to program leadership;
  • Creating and distributing a monthly program bulletin with key updates, events, and highlights;
  • Performing clerical tasks such as filing, data entry, and document organization;
  • Supporting professional development and program trainings with logistical assistance;
  • Communicating regularly with the STARS administrative team to share updates, concerns, and site needs;
  • Participating in staff meetings and professional development opportunities; and
  • Other duties as assigned.

Minimum Qualifications

REQUIREMENTS:
  • Must be 18 years of age or older.
  • Experience working in an office setting supporting administrative or customer service tasks 
  • Ability to work flexible hours including afternoons, evenings, and occasional weekends or holidays.
  • Must be willing to work at least one (1) City Festival annually.
  • Possession of, or ability to obtain, First Aid/CPR/AED certification within 6 months of employment.
  • Ability to remain calm and respond appropriately in emergency situations.
  • Positive attitude, strong communication skills, and commitment to teamwork.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S:
  • Must possess a High School diploma or equivalent. 
    • College level training is desirable.
    • Incumbent employees are expected to avail themselves of staff development as provided by the City.
  • Prior paid job-related experience successfully working with students in a learning situation is highly desirable.
CONDITIONS OF EMPLOYMENT:
  • Must successfully clear the City's background process, which includes DOJ Live Scan fingerprinting, reference checks, drug and alcohol screening, TB test, and assessment (reading comprehension, math fluency, and supervision testing). 
  • Must attend paid trainings, which include First-Aid/CPR/AED certification, Mandated Reporter Training, and other trainings as required by the City.
WORKING CONDITIONS:  
Performance of assigned duties and responsibilities may include prolonged standing, sitting, walking on level or unleveled surfaces, reaching, twisting, turning, kneeling, bending, stooping, squatting, crouching, grasping, pushing, pulling, carrying, and making repetitive hand movement in the performance of daily duties. Incumbents may be required to lift, carry and/or push objects weighing 25 pounds or more.
